Quote from Adrian Monk in Mr. Monk Buys a House

Adrian Monk: I might be interested. In- In the house. I- I might want to buy it.
Captain Stottlemeyer: You what?
Adrian Monk: Just have- I just have one question. Do any of the neighbors play piano?
Pamela Moody: I wouldn't know. The walls are so thick you can't really hear anything.
Adrian Monk: Really?
Captain Stottlemeyer: Monk, come here. You are tired. You're not thinking straight. You're between shrinks. You can't be making any big decisions right now.
Adrian Monk: You can't hear anything.
Captain Stottlemeyer: Monk, look. We all miss Dr. Kroger. Go home. Get some sleep. You- You can't just buy a house on some crazy impulse. [both chuckle]
Adrian Monk: I'll take it.
